“Pokémon Patents” granted to Nintendo for certain in-game mechanics have triggered major concern from indie developers, who fear they're overly broad and will create legal uncertainty.

– Joe Foley on Creative Bloq

#gamenews #gameindustry #games #videogames #game #videogame #indiedev #indiedevs
Are Nintendo's controversial new patents a disaster for game design?
There are fears sweeping patents will limit indie developers' creative freedom.

A 5 year-old girl with a rare eye condition called nystagmus is participating in a pioneering clinical trial that uses games developed by @unisouthampton.bsky.social to improve #vision by tracking eye movements and assessing how quickly a child can see. – BBC #game #games #videogames #videogame
'Eyesight video game offers my daughter genuine hope'
Five-year-old Nevaeh has a rare condition that makes her eyes move uncontrollably .

A #GTA5 Easter egg (creepy laugh in the Los Santos sewers) has been explained by a YouTuber who found the audio file in the game’s code. It's a nod to "Ratman" – a player-created #GTA4 urban myth from English folklore.

@gamesradarplus.bsky.social

#game #games #videogames
GTA 5 sleuth finally has an explanation for this 12-year-old Easter egg, and it turns out it has roots in a GTA 4 urban myth
And it all stems back to a British seaside town

Desimulate of @omwgamestudio.bsky.social wants to turn his viral #AI clip into a #game – but AI-generated meshes have too many polygons and are too messy for open-world RPGs, so he'll build it from scratch using the art as a reference.

@kotakudotcom.bsky.social's @ethangach.bsky.social
#gamedev
AI Made A Viral Clip Of An RPG But Can't Make The Game Itself
An AI-generated clip of an old-school first-person RPG is too hard for AI to make into an actual game

Final Fantasy launched w/a game-breaking bug that #gamedevs (incl Uematsu) warned players about by inserting a handwritten slip of paper into 500k+ #game boxes that read: "If this happens, the game will break, so do not delete this..."

@gamesradarplus.bsky.social

#gamehistory #gamedev #games
The original Final Fantasy launched with a game-breaking bug that Square noticed too late to fix, so devs had to slip a warning into 500,000 copies of the JRPG: "Do not delete this..."
"If this happens, the game will break"
